About This Item

London: Robert Hardwicke, 1862. recently rebacked copy with new endpapers and green buckram spine, surviving part of original spine glued on, attractive gilt-decorated front cover, rear board decorated in blind, 324 pages, all edges gilt, with 25 hand-coloured plates illustrating hundreds of species, some foxing and browning affecting foredge and occasionally at spine edges of text, but overall a clean sound copy. Book is undated, but other sellers mention 1862. Sowerby's Plate 2 is signed and dated August 1861.. Fifth Edition.. Hard Cover. Good/No Jacket. Illus. by Sowerby, John E.. 8vo - over 7¾" - 9¾" tall.
